chore: do not use sentinel errors when unneeded
- main reason being it's a burden to always define sentinel errors at global scope, wrap them with `%w` instead of using a string directly - only use sentinel errors when it has to be checked using `errors.Is` - replace all usage of these sentinel errors in `fmt.Errorf` with direct strings that were in the sentinel error - exclude the sentinel error definition requirement from .golangci.yml - update unit tests to use ContainersError instead of ErrorIs so it stays as a "not a change detector test" without requiring a sentinel error
